My Journey Back From Injury


I obtained my master’s degree at Fei Tian College and am now a dancer with Shen Yun Performing Arts. After more than ten years studying at Fei Tian and working with Shen Yun, I would like to share some of my experiences.


I believe that any professional dancer would agree: every beautiful moment on stage is rooted in hard work, sweat, and tears. Just as in life, there are no shortcuts in dance. All too often, I’d put in a mountain of effort to move just an inch forward, and in that process, there might be accidents or even injuries. I’m sure that I’m not alone in my experience—it’s unavoidable for many dancers.


Two years ago, I injured my hip during tumbling practice. My company manager rushed to the studio once she heard about my fall. I wanted to grit my teeth through the pain, but I couldn’t hold back and started to cry when I saw her concern and care. I felt her motherly affection in her eyes and in her questions; she also teared up when I cried to her. Honestly, I could tell that the injury was not serious and figured I would just rest for a few days. But my manager was adamant and immediately contacted a physician for an X-ray exam, even though it was already late at night. Indeed, the X-ray showed that there was nothing to worry about. By then, my company was elbow-deep in dress rehearsals, and I had taken on several principal roles in the program. Even so, my manager forbade me from doing any dancing at all and told me to rest.


I took time off to recover, but was a little worried that I would fall behind in rehearsals. Once I rejoined, I stretched just a little too far and aggravated the same injury. This time, my manager suggested that I get an MRI scan. The scan revealed a torn hip ligament—I knew that I needed surgery. My manager was the one who made the arrangements for me while Shen Yun funded the treatment.


That endless support has allowed me to keep dancing on stage to this day. I will always be grateful to the people at Shen Yun who have helped me achieve my dreams! Throughout my recovery, there were always warm smiles to help me with daily life since I could not easily move around on my own. Truly, my manager’s care and encouragement helped me stay optimistic about my return to the stage.


To me, the ways that Shen Yun cares for its members and the ways that Fei Tian cares for its students all demonstrate true generosity of the human spirit. The world is a big place, and I’m so glad to know this remarkable environment of humaneness, warmth, and love.
